Dwight never fit D'Antoni's system. D'Antoni is a great coach for the type of system he wants to run. The problem is you need the perfect personnel to get this done. You need a dynamic PG, athletic wings and a stretch 4/5.

The NBA in general is shifting towards this type of play and you see a lot more players now capable of running the type of system D'Antoni has pretty much created.

That being said, he'd fail miserably with Harden on his team. He's pretty much the anti-D'Antoni player.

Dwight never fit D'Antoni's system. D'Antoni is a great coach for the type of system he wants to run. The problem is you need the perfect personnel to get this done. You need a dynamic PG, athletic wings and a stretch 4/5.

I don't know about that. Dwight is plenty athletic enough to play in that system. He is as athletic as Amare Stoudemire was, but doesn't have the overall offense of Stoudemire. Amare used to get a lot of shots right at the rim, which is where Dwight is most effective, because it uses a lot of pick and roll.

Where he wouldn't be as effective is Amare used to be able to step out and hit 10-15 footers, which isn't happening with Dwight.

I do agree though, that with Dwight they would need a stretch 4 because Dwight is definitely not a stretch 5.
